
I was able to take in the press conference for the signing of Matt Hobgood Saturday.
The first-round draft choice for the Orioles this year has all the tools, including a fastball that touches 97 - with an understanding that getting ahead in the count and mixing his pitches is what works at the highest levels.
One of the most important tools he seems to have is mental toughness. Matt's dad passed when he was just a kid, and it looks like his mom did a great job raising him. He is well mannered and very articulate.
To have all this - getting drafted and signing with a Major League team - happen to him so fast and with the media just waiting to get a piece of him, he looks like he's on top of it. Confident, not cocky. I like that a lot.
He is on his way to Bluefield, West Virginia to start his professional career. It won't be easy because it never is for a prospect.
